Integration of pitch regulated fixed speed wind turbine in a radial distribution system
This paper is concerned with developing model of pitch regulated fixed speed (PRFS) type of wind turbine generators (WTG) used as distributed generation (DG) sources and demonstrating its application for steady state analysis. The model for this class of WTG developed here facilitates the computation of terminal voltages for a specified wind speed. The proposed model has been used to investigate the impact of WTG integrating in power system by different number of WTG on terminal voltage variation. The application of the proposed model for the load flow analysis of radial systems having WTG has been described. The load flow method used in this paper is balance radial load flow based on forward-backward method. Simulation studies have been carried out on a 33 bus radial distribution system consisting WTG sources to illustrate the application of the proposed model developed by using MATLAB.
